0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會(huì)員中心
电子发烧友
开通电子发烧友VIP会员 尊享10大特权
海量资料免费下载
精品直播免费看
优质内容免费畅学
课程9折专享价
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

算法與數(shù)據(jù)結(jié)構(gòu)

文章:333 被閱讀:684.3w 粉絲數(shù):37 關(guān)注數(shù):0 點(diǎn)贊數(shù):33

廣告

TimSort:一個(gè)在標(biāo)準(zhǔn)函數(shù)庫(kù)中廣泛使用的排序算法

在計(jì)算機(jī)科學(xué)的領(lǐng)域,排序算法是每位學(xué)生必學(xué)的基礎(chǔ),而排序的需求是每位程序員在編程過(guò)程中都會(huì)遇到的。 ....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 01-03 11:42 ?565次閱讀

小米14開機(jī)動(dòng)畫顯示澎湃OS基于Android

澎湃 OS 發(fā)布前,不少人都爭(zhēng)論,它不是小米自研的系統(tǒng),對(duì)此雷軍還特意表示,確實(shí)不是。小米的澎湃 O....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-02 15:37 ?2453次閱讀
小米14開機(jī)動(dòng)畫顯示澎湃OS基于Android

這么簡(jiǎn)單的二叉樹算法都不會(huì)?

這個(gè)題目是leetcode的第572題,要求是這樣的:給定兩顆二叉樹A和B,判斷B是否是A的子樹。
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 08-29 11:19 ?1104次閱讀
這么簡(jiǎn)單的二叉樹算法都不會(huì)?

京東又開源一款新框架,用起來(lái)真優(yōu)雅!

DripTable 分為兩種應(yīng)用場(chǎng)景:配置端和應(yīng)用端。配置端主要負(fù)責(zé)通過(guò)可視化方式和 low-cod....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 08-24 16:04 ?819次閱讀
京東又開源一款新框架,用起來(lái)真優(yōu)雅!

不同語(yǔ)言運(yùn)行100萬(wàn)個(gè)并發(fā)任務(wù)需要多少內(nèi)存?

在這篇博客文章中,我深入探討了異步和多線程編程在內(nèi)存消耗方面的比較,跨足了如Rust、Go、Java....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 07-12 14:14 ?897次閱讀
不同語(yǔ)言運(yùn)行100萬(wàn)個(gè)并發(fā)任務(wù)需要多少內(nèi)存?

算法面試真題:完美走位

在第一人稱射擊游戲中,玩家通過(guò)鍵盤的 A、S、D、W 四個(gè)按鍵控制游戲人物分別向左、向后、向右、向前....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 06-15 11:24 ?672次閱讀

AlphaDev驚世登場(chǎng),顛覆人類算法格局!

在人類歷史中,排序方法一直在演變。最早的例子可以追溯到二、三世紀(jì),那時(shí)的學(xué)者們?cè)趤啔v山大圖書館的書架....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 06-13 11:48 ?1051次閱讀
AlphaDev驚世登場(chǎng),顛覆人類算法格局!

打臉了!微軟發(fā)布自己的Linux!

至于為何微軟會(huì)選擇在自家服務(wù)中使用Linux系統(tǒng)呢?答案很簡(jiǎn)單,Linux系統(tǒng)在執(zhí)行特定任務(wù)時(shí)擁有比....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 06-08 15:24 ?889次閱讀
打臉了!微軟發(fā)布自己的Linux!

你們知道前端大神是怎么學(xué)CSS的嘛

有人說(shuō),要成為前端高手很容易:先學(xué)好 HTML/CSS/JavaScript 三劍客,再學(xué)會(huì)三大前端....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 05-30 11:26 ?874次閱讀

你會(huì)使用 Linux 編輯器 vim 嗎?

vim:是一款編輯器,只負(fù)責(zé)寫代碼;相當(dāng)于 windows 的記事本;
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 05-10 18:21 ?1119次閱讀
你會(huì)使用 Linux 編輯器 vim 嗎?

STL中的堆算法該如何使用呢?

了解過(guò)數(shù)據(jù)結(jié)構(gòu)的人,應(yīng)該對(duì)堆結(jié)構(gòu)不陌生,堆的底層是使用數(shù)組來(lái)實(shí)現(xiàn)的,但卻保持了二叉樹的特性。
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 04-19 16:42 ?1458次閱讀

徹底理解編輯距離問(wèn)題edit distance

這是動(dòng)態(tài)規(guī)劃主題的第三篇,本篇的題目非常經(jīng)典,幾乎是面試必備,即,編輯距離問(wèn)題,edit dista....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 04-10 14:04 ?1603次閱讀

一致性哈希算法簡(jiǎn)介

最近有一位讀者跟我交流,說(shuō)除了算法題之外,系統(tǒng)設(shè)計(jì)題是一大痛點(diǎn)。算法題起碼有很多刷題平臺(tái)可以動(dòng)手實(shí)踐....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 04-04 11:53 ?920次閱讀

匯總幾個(gè)在算法題以及工程開發(fā)中常用的位運(yùn)算技巧

所以本文由淺入深,先展示幾個(gè)有趣(但沒卵用)的位運(yùn)算技巧,然后再匯總幾個(gè)在算法題以及工程開發(fā)中常用的....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 03-13 09:16 ?861次閱讀

淺析LeetCode 83刪除排序鏈表中的重復(fù)元素

給定一個(gè)已排序的鏈表的頭 head , 刪除所有重復(fù)的元素,使每個(gè)元素只出現(xiàn)一次 。返回 已排序的鏈....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 02-06 10:25 ?926次閱讀

介紹一款Linux、數(shù)據(jù)庫(kù)、Redis、MongoDB統(tǒng)一管理平臺(tái)

基于DDD分層實(shí)現(xiàn)的web版 linux(終端 文件 腳本 進(jìn)程)、數(shù)據(jù)庫(kù)(mysql postgr....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 02-01 16:56 ?1621次閱讀

LeetCode876鏈表的中間結(jié)點(diǎn)介紹

給定一個(gè)頭結(jié)點(diǎn)為 head 的非空單鏈表,返回鏈表的中間結(jié)點(diǎn)。
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 01-11 17:58 ?1033次閱讀
LeetCode876鏈表的中間結(jié)點(diǎn)介紹

LeetCode 26:刪除有序數(shù)組中的重復(fù)項(xiàng)

在每次遍歷過(guò)程中,比較 i 和 j 指向的元素值大小,把大的元素填充到 cur 的位置,填充完畢說(shuō)明....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 12-21 10:34 ?818次閱讀

程序員必知的89個(gè)操作系統(tǒng)核心概念

shell:它是一個(gè)程序,可從鍵盤獲取命令并將其提供給操作系統(tǒng)以執(zhí)行。在過(guò)去,它是類似 Unix 的....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 12-13 11:37 ?922次閱讀

網(wǎng)頁(yè)爬蟲及其用到的算法和數(shù)據(jù)結(jié)構(gòu)

網(wǎng)絡(luò)爬蟲程序的優(yōu)劣,很大程度上反映了一個(gè)搜索引擎的好差。不信,你可以隨便拿一個(gè)網(wǎng)站去查詢一下各家搜索....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 12-02 11:30 ?1109次閱讀

面試經(jīng)驗(yàn)分享之?dāng)?shù)據(jù)結(jié)構(gòu)、算法題

Google 和 Facebook 這類對(duì)算法有很高要求的公司的在線測(cè)試我沒有參加過(guò)(不過(guò)在牛人內(nèi)推....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-30 11:37 ?752次閱讀

那些微軟出品的逆天小工具,你都用過(guò)嗎?

再例如,可以用 Shortcut Guide 快捷鍵指南來(lái)隨時(shí)查看各種快捷鍵,長(zhǎng)按 Win 鍵 1 ....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-24 14:24 ?1201次閱讀

圖論算法有圖有代碼

歐拉把頂點(diǎn)的度定義為與該頂點(diǎn)相關(guān)聯(lián)的邊的條數(shù),并且他證明了存在從任意點(diǎn)出發(fā),經(jīng)過(guò)所有邊恰好一次,并最....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-22 11:28 ?972次閱讀

以智能算力助推AI制藥 阿里云全球AI生物智藥大賽火熱進(jìn)行中

另一方面,《以臨床價(jià)值為導(dǎo)向的抗腫瘤藥物臨床研發(fā)指導(dǎo)原則》、《關(guān)于促進(jìn)人工智能和實(shí)體經(jīng)濟(jì)深度融合的指....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-17 09:42 ?1061次閱讀

八大排序算法

將一個(gè)記錄插入到已排序好的有序表中,從而得到一個(gè)新,記錄數(shù)增1的有序表。即:先將序列的第1個(gè)記錄看成....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-17 09:40 ?823次閱讀

為什么要使用數(shù)據(jù)結(jié)構(gòu)和算法

博文中的數(shù)據(jù)結(jié)構(gòu)均被實(shí)現(xiàn)為對(duì)象,本節(jié)是為了給那些還沒有接觸過(guò)面向?qū)ο缶幊痰淖x者準(zhǔn)備的,但是,短短的一....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-14 11:24 ?962次閱讀

五張圖帶你體會(huì)堆算法

二叉堆是一種特殊的堆,二叉堆是完全二叉樹或者近似完全二叉樹,二叉堆滿足堆特性:父節(jié)點(diǎn)的鍵值總是保持固....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-10 09:29 ?1115次閱讀

說(shuō)透游戲中常用的兩種隨機(jī)算法

這些 2D 游戲相較現(xiàn)在的大型 3D 游戲雖然看起來(lái)有些簡(jiǎn)陋,但依然用到很多有趣算法技巧,本文就來(lái)深....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-09 11:17 ?1338次閱讀

以非遞歸的形式來(lái)寫快速排序

快速排序想必大家都知道,我們以數(shù)組中的某個(gè)數(shù)字為基準(zhǔn),通常是數(shù)組的第一個(gè)或者最后一個(gè)(當(dāng)然也可以是其....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-08 17:01 ?827次閱讀

龍芯LoongArch龍架構(gòu)平臺(tái)對(duì)于OpenHarmony已形成初步支持

下一步,龍芯中科將與潤(rùn)和軟件合作,繼續(xù)完成更多龍架構(gòu)芯片與OpenHarmony的適配,共建基于龍架....
的頭像 算法與數(shù)據(jù)結(jié)構(gòu) 發(fā)表于 11-03 11:46 ?1173次閱讀

電子發(fā)燒友

中國(guó)電子工程師最喜歡的網(wǎng)站

  • 2931785位工程師會(huì)員交流學(xué)習(xí)
  • 獲取您個(gè)性化的科技前沿技術(shù)信息
  • 參加活動(dòng)獲取豐厚的禮品